1. An image generation apparatus comprising:
an image data generating section configured to generate data of a display image;
a frame buffer configured to store data of an image generated;
a format control section configured to, in a case where the image data generating section executes alpha compositing of a plurality of images, switch a data format of pixel values to be stored in the frame buffer; and
an output section configured to read the data of the image from the frame buffer, convert the data into a format corresponding to a display, and output resulting data,
wherein the format control section switches the data format by changing:
whether a decimal point of the data to be stored is fixed or floats, and
the number of bits to be assigned to each color.
